gzgetss

(PHP 3, PHP 4 , PHP 5)

gzgetss --  Get line from gz-file pointer and strip HTML tags

Description

string gzgetss ( resource zp, int length [, string allowable_tags] )

Identical to gzgets(), except that gzgetss() attempts to strip any HTML and PHP tags from the text it reads.

Parameters

zp

The gz-file pointer. It must be valid, and must point to a file successfully opened by gzopen().

length

The length of data to get.

allowable_tags

You can use this optional parameter to specify tags which should not be stripped.

Return Values

The uncompressed and striped string, or FALSE on error.

ChangeLog

VersionDescription
3.0.13 and 4.0b3 allowable_tags was added.

Examples

Example 1. gzgetss() example

<?php
$handle
= gzopen('somefile.gz', 'r');
while (!
gzeof($handle)) {
   
$buffer = gzgetss($handle, 4096);
   echo
$buffer;
}
gzlose($handle);
?>
